Output 58efc2acb7da0722a31445cd6d7ea11ae0ec6d396fa7af7be7f5bf64484f95df:0

value
3190023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bbd5bc7e1153785837116b0f539f36a366f1568 OP_EQUAL
address
3Joh8Gzee1yFrVKyf4Dyz37ShdUvvh7c6a
transaction
58efc2acb7da0722a31445cd6d7ea11ae0ec6d396fa7af7be7f5bf64484f95df
spent
true